The son of artist Wycliffe Egginton, RI (1875-1951), Frank Egginton was born in Cheshire and first visited Ireland in the 1930s. He is synonymous with views in watercolour of the Irish countryside, particularly county Donegal. From the early 1930s many of his works were shown at the RHA, and later, from 1952 at the Victor Waddington Gallery in Dublin. In the UK his works were shown at the Fine Art Society and Royal Institute of Painters in Water Colours, London and the Walker Art Gallery, Liverpool among others. The artist's daughter and son-in-law own 'The Gallery', Dunfanaghy Co. Donegal since 1968.
